We are a family business that celebrated fifteen years in January of 2025. We have been making things all of our lives and when Walter and I met we decided to merge our interests into one magical unknown entity we called Peg and Awl. Our business began, like many things in our lives, without a plan — just the desire to make useful objects and take them on life’s adventures and add to them our own stories and marks and scribbles. We love reusing old things and using sustainable materials wherever possible including vegetable tanned leather, FSC Certified wood, and recycled silver and gold for our jewelry. We make very little waste and hand make everything in our barn in West Chester, Pennsylvania, where we also have a storefront open most weekdays from 10am-5pm!
